End Call Dropouts: Strategies for Effective On-Hold Communication
Call dropouts can be frustration for both customers and businesses. When a customer is placed on hold, they need to get clear and informative communication about the situation. Providing a positive holding experience can lower call dropouts and increase customer satisfaction. One effective strategy is to offer real-time updates on estimated wait times, using short messages that are easy to grasp. You can also feature calming music or relaxing sounds to create a more pleasant experience.
- Employ personalized messages that address the customer by name, if possible.
- Offer self-service options through interactive voice response (IVR) menus to aid customers with common inquiries.
- Maintain clear and professional call handling procedures to minimize hold times.
By implementing these strategies, businesses can improve their on-hold communication and successfully reduce call dropouts.
